Medical experts acknowledge AI’s potential role in improving healthcare delivery, though they doubt its suitability as a standard chatbot solution.

Dr. Sina Bari, who works as a surgeon and serves as a leading expert in AI applications within the technology firm iMerit, has witnessed firsthand how ChatGPT can provide patients with incorrect medical advice that may lead them down the wrong path.

“I recently saw a patient come to me. After I suggested a particular medication, they showed me a conversation generated by ChatGPT claiming that using that drug carried a 45% risk of developing pulmonary embolism,” Dr. Bari shared with TechCrunch.

Upon further investigation, Dr. Bari discovered that the statistic in question came from a research paper examining the effects of that medication on a specific subgroup of people suffering from tuberculosis — information that was completely irrelevant to his patient’s situation.

Despite this issue, when OpenAI unveiled its dedicated ChatGPT Health chatbot last week, Dr. Bari felt more enthusiasm than concern.

ChatGPT Health, which is set to launch in the coming weeks, enables users to discuss their health concerns in a more private setting. Additionally, it ensures that the messages sent through this platform are not used as training data for the underlying AI model.

“I think it’s an excellent development,” Dr. Bari said. “Since something like this is already being used, formalizing it with proper safeguards to protect patient information will make it even more valuable for patients seeking guidance.”

Users can receive more tailored advice through ChatGPT Health by uploading their medical records and syncing them with apps such as Apple Health and MyFitnessPal. However, this feature raises immediate concerns for those who prioritize data security.

“Suddenly, medical data is being transferred from organizations that comply with HIPAA regulations to vendors that do not,” Itai Schwartz, co-founder of the data loss prevention company MIND, told TechCrunch. “So I’m curious to see how regulatory bodies plan to address this situation.”

From the perspective of some industry professionals, however, the damage has already been done. Nowadays, instead of searching online for symptoms, people prefer to consult AI chatbots — with over 230 million users interacting with ChatGPT regarding their health each week.

“This represents one of the most significant use cases for ChatGPT to date,” Andrew Brackin, a partner at Gradient who specializes in investing in health technology, told TechCrunch. “It makes perfect sense that they would want to create a more private, secure, and optimized version of ChatGPT specifically for handling healthcare-related queries.”

AI chatbots suffer from a persistent issue known as hallucinations, which poses a particularly serious concern in the healthcare sector. According to Vectara’s Factual Consistency Evaluation Model, OpenAI’s GPT-5 tends to generate more false information than many models developed by Google and Anthropic. Nevertheless, AI companies see potential in using these technologies to address inefficiencies within healthcare (Anthropic also announced a health-related product this week).

For Dr. Nigam Shah, a professor of medicine at Stanford University and the chief data scientist for Stanford Health Care, the difficulty American patients face in accessing medical care is an even more pressing issue than the risk of ChatGPT providing inaccurate advice.

“Right now, if you try to see a primary care doctor through any health system, you can expect to wait anywhere from three to six months,” Dr. Shah said. “If you had to choose between waiting six months for a human physician or speaking with an AI tool that can still assist you with certain medical needs, which would you opt for?”

Dr. Shah believes that the most effective way to integrate AI into healthcare systems is by focusing on changes on the provider side rather than among patients.

Medical journals have frequently reported that administrative tasks account for approximately half of a primary care physician’s working time, which significantly reduces the number of patients they can see in a given day. Automating such tasks could allow doctors to see more patients, potentially reducing the need for people to rely on tools like ChatGPT Health without first consulting a real physician.

Dr. Shah leads a team at Stanford that is developing ChatEHR, a software application designed to be integrated directly into electronic health record systems. This tool enables clinicians to access patients’ medical records more efficiently and streamline their workflow.

“Making electronic health records more user-friendly means physicians can spend less time searching through complex records to find the information they need,” Dr. Sneha Jain, one of the early testers of ChatEHR, stated in an article published by Stanford Medicine. “ChatEHR helps them obtain this information quickly, allowing them to focus on what is truly important — communicating with patients and understanding their health conditions.”

Anthropic is also developing AI products aimed at being used by clinicians and insurance companies, in addition to its publicly available Claude chatbot. This week, Anthropic introduced Claude for Healthcare, explaining how it can be utilized to reduce the time spent on tedious administrative tasks such as submitting prior authorization requests to insurance providers.

“Some of you handle hundreds or even thousands of prior authorization cases per week,” said Anthropic’s Chief Product Officer, Mike Krieger, during a recent presentation at J.P. Morgan’s Healthcare Conference. “So just imagine cutting 20 or 30 minutes off each of those processes — that would represent substantial time savings.”

As AI and medicine become increasingly intertwined, an inevitable tension exists between these two fields. Doctors are primarily motivated by their commitment to helping patients, while technology companies are ultimately accountable to their shareholders, even if their intentions are well-intentioned.

“I believe that this tension is very important,” Dr. Bari said. “Patients rely on us to be cautious and conservative in order to safeguard their interests.”
